Zungeru, located in Niger State, Nigeria, is a town steeped in history, having served as the capital of the British protectorate of Northern Nigeria from 1902 to 1916. Today, it is home to the Niger State Polytechnic, making it a center for education in the region. The town is beautifully situated on the Kaduna River, providing scenic views and a tranquil atmosphere. Visitors can explore its colonial past and enjoy the serene environment that the river offers.
